Lenny Kravitz Teases Memoir “Let Love Rule”

Lenny Kravitz went on quite a journey since kicking off his career in the 80s. He established himself as a successful musician, producer, and actor—and he’s ready to take a look back at his early years in the new memoir, Let Love Rule.

Kravitz’s new book will hit the shelves on October 6th. He picked the title Let Love Rule because love is his message and a force that paved the way for all of his experiences—but it also happens to be the title of his debut album.

“Writing this memoir has been a beautiful and interesting experience taking me through the first 25 years of my life, from birth to release of my first album. That journey, full of adventure, was where I found myself and my voice,” said the Grammy-winning singer in a statement.

Kravitz wrote the book alongside David Ritz. It will cover his childhood and all the obstacles he had to overcome before dropping his debut album in 1989.
